Manchester City's Sergio Aguero scored arguably the most memorable goal of the decade as his last gasp winner clinched his club their first Premier League title back in 2012 and the Argentine marksman has been in a league of his own when it comes to scoring goals since 2010.

Aguero secured his place in City folklore long before he broke the club's scoring record and he continues to be a potent scoring threat in his ninth full season with the club.

Tottenham's Harry Kane is second in the top scorers list for the decade, with his lofty placing all the more impressive as he didn't break into the Spurs first team at Premier League level until 2014.

Jose Mourinho (right) wants to turn Harry Kane into a winner (John Walton/PA)

Manchester United's all-time record scorer Wayne Rooney is next on a list that features just one member of Liverpool's current forward line that looks set to end the club's 30-year wait for a domestic league title.

Liverpool forward Mohamed Salah just missed out on a place in the top ten, but he is Liverpool's top scorer of the decade after firing 84 goals in all competitions from just two and a half seasons at Anfield.

Top Premier League scorers since January 1st 2010

1 Sergio Aguero (Manchester City) - 174

2 Harry Kane (Tottenham) - 136

3 Wayne Rooney (Manchester United, Everton) - 114

4 Romelu Lukaku (Chelsea, West Brom, Everton, Manchester United) - 113

5 Robin Van Persie (Arsenal, Manchester United) - 98

6 Jamie Vardy (Leicester) 97

7 Eden Hazard (Chelsea) 85

8 Olivier Giroud (Arsenal, Chelsea) 78

9 Raheem Sterling (Liverpool, Manchester City) 77

10 Sadio Mane (Southampton, Liverpool) - 76

